Jan Jackson
Jan Jackson, director of Passing Measures, has been directing and
performing with professional and educational Early Music ensembles in
Central Texas for over 20 years. She has participated in various Early
Ms. Jackson performs with the Texas Early Music Project, in addition to directing and performing with Passing Measures (medieval, renaissance, and baroque repertoire) and Timely Treasures (harp/recorder duo with early music and celtic repertoire).
She has served on the National Board of Directors for the American Recorder
Society and on the Educational Committee for that organization. A
registered Suzuki recorder instructor, she is a charter member of the
American Recorder Teachers Association, a member of its board of directors
and the chair person for ARTA's Scholarship Committee. She is a faculty
member for the Armstrong Community Music School (South Austin), and the
Texas TOOT (formerly Texas Early Music Festival). She teaches in students'
homes, at workshops, at the the First Baptist Church in Blanco, Texas, and
privately at her studio, the Academie of Musick (North Central Austin).
